4-bedroom Detached Villa in La Herradura

Situated in the picturesque bay of La Herradura, this detached villa offers panoramic views of the Mediterranean Sea and surrounding mountains. Built in 1989, the property features four bedrooms and three bathrooms across 396 square metres of living space. With a substantial 940-square-metre plot, the residence benefits from multiple terraces and a heated infinity pool, all within walking distance of local beaches. The property represents established coastal living in the Granada province, combining practical amenities with spectacular natural surroundings.

Accessibility & Amenities

The villa offers practical access to essential amenities, with the nearest supermarket positioned just 139 metres away for daily necessities. Pharmacy services are available within 762 metres. Beach access includes Playa del Muerto at 1.5 kilometres, Playa de los Berengueles at 1.6 kilometres, and Playa de Cotobro at 2.0 kilometres, providing options for coastal recreation. The property's connection to the motorway network places Málaga at approximately 55 minutes by car and Granada at 45 minutes, offering access to major urban centres. Specialised medical facilities require a 19-kilometre journey to the nearest hospital. Golf enthusiasts face considerable travel, with the nearest courses located 66-70 kilometres away. The nearest airport facilities are positioned 68 kilometres from the property, necessitating advance planning for international travel.

La Herradura benefits from a distinctive microclimate on Spain's Tropical Coast, characterised by moderate temperatures ranging between 18°C and 25°C throughout the year. The region receives more than 330 days of sunshine annually, creating optimal conditions for outdoor living. The property's elevation provides natural ventilation during summer months while maintaining comfortable temperatures during winter. The southeast orientation ensures morning sun on the principal terraces, creating pleasant outdoor spaces for breakfast activities. The Mediterranean climate features dry summers with minimal rainfall between June and September, while winter precipitation typically occurs in manageable amounts without disrupting daily activities. This climate pattern enables use of the heated swimming pool throughout most of the year, maximising the property's outdoor amenities.
